MATH1305 — Quantitative Literacy

4.5 credits · 4.5 hours

4.5 Credits Students will gain the mathematical, statistical, and computational skills necessary to explore real-life situations. Students will learn and practice critical-thinking and problem-solving skills using quantitative information to make responsible decisions in a variety of areas such as finance, health, and the environment. 5

Prerequisites: MATH0960
